Re: [Question #12326]: Firefox frequently freezing

I've posted this on an ubuntu thread also but here goes:

OK so I've been fighting this problem for several weeks. No one seemed
to know why firefox would freeze in Ubuntu 8 and 9. I figured it out by
running firefox in debug mode. "NSPR_LOG_MODULES=all:5 firefox"

Every time firefox froze I would see "resolving safebrowsing-
cache.google.com". So I tried the usual ping, nslookup and the results
were very inconsistent. Sometimes it would resolve but mostly just time
out.


After a little googling I found out that firefox has built in Google Safe Search that frequently communicates with safebrowsing-cache.google.com.

So I disabled this safe search feature and NO MORE LOCK UPS!!

You can disable This safe search feature by going to Edit - Preferences
- Security, uncheck "Block reported attack sites" and "Block reported
web forgeries" .

Hope this helps some of you, it was very frustrating for me.
